2核2G服务器能否安装SQL Server 2008?——结论与详细分析
结论与核心观点
可以安装,但不推荐用于生产环境。SQL Server 2008的最低配置要求为1核1G,2核2G勉强满足基础运行需求,但性能会严重受限,尤其在并发访问或复杂查询时可能崩溃。仅适合测试、学习或极低负载场景。
详细分析
1. SQL Server 2008的官方配置要求
- 最低配置:
- CPU:1核(x86或x64)
- 内存:1GB(Express版512MB)
- 磁盘空间:至少2.2GB
- 推荐配置:
- CPU:2核以上
- 内存:4GB+(企业版建议8GB+)
- 磁盘:SSD优先
关键点:
- 2核2G仅达到最低门槛,无法支撑实际业务压力。
- 若启用高级功能(如SSIS、Analysis Services),资源消耗会进一步增加。
2. 2核2G的实际运行表现
- 优点:
- 可完成安装并启动服务。
- 适合单用户本地开发或简单查询测试。
- 致命缺陷:
- 内存瓶颈:SQL Server会占用大量内存缓存数据,2G内存可能导致频繁磁盘交换(I/O延迟飙升)。
- 并发能力差:超过5个并发连接时,响应速度显著下降甚至超时。
- 稳定性风险:长期运行可能因资源耗尽崩溃。
3. 适用场景与替代方案
适用场景(临时/非关键用途):
- 个人学习或演示环境。
- 小型单机应用(如本地ERP测试)。
不适用场景:
- 生产环境、Web应用后端、多用户系统。
替代方案:
- 升级硬件:至少4核4G(推荐8G内存)。
- 使用轻量级数据库:如MySQL、PostgreSQL或SQLite(资源占用更低)。
- 云数据库服务:阿里云RDS、Azure SQL等(免运维,弹性扩展)。
4. 优化建议(若必须安装)
- 关闭非必要服务:禁用SSAS、SSRS等组件。
- 限制内存使用:在SQL Server配置中设置最大内存为1.5GB(预留系统资源)。
- 优化查询:避免复杂JOIN或全表扫描,建立索引。
- 定期重启:释放内存碎片。
最终建议
2核2G能装SQL Server 2008,但仅限临时测试。若需长期使用或承载业务,务必升级配置或迁移至更高效的数据库方案。资源不足是数据库性能的头号杀手,强行部署可能导致数据丢失或服务不可用。
CLOUD云枢